Robotics & Digital Solutions, part of the Johnson & Johnson family of companies, is recruiting for a Senior FPGA Engineer located in Santa Clara, CA.
At Johnson & Johnson Robotics and Digital Solutions, we’re changing the trajectory of health for humanity, using robotics to enhance healthcare providers’ abilities and improve patients’ diagnoses, treatments, and recovery times. Johnson & Johnson Robotics and Digital Solutions was established in 2020 with the integration of Auris Health, Verb Surgical, C-SATS, and Ethicon. It comprises three key med-tech platforms: Flexible Robotics (MONARCH®), Surgical Robotics (OTTAVA™), and Digital Solutions. Overview:
We are seeking a highly skilled and experienced FPGA Engineer to join our dynamic engineering team. The ideal candidate will have a strong background in FPGA design and development, along with a passion for innovation and a commitment to delivering high-quality solutions. You will be responsible for developing, testing, and implementing FPGA-based designs in Surgical Robotics space.
Responsibilities
Design, develop, and implement FPGA architectures and algorithms.
Collaborate cross-functionally with hardware and software engineers to integrate FPGA designs.
Conduct simulations and performance analysis to verify design functionality and optimize performance.
Troubleshoot and debug complex FPGA designs in both simulation and physical hardware.
Develop and maintain technical documentation, including design specifications, test plans, and reports.
Required Qualifications
Bachelor’s degree in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, or related engineering field.
Minimum of 5+ years of experience in FPGA design and development.
Proficient in VHDL and/or Verilog, with experience in Xilinx Vivado.
Strong understanding of digital signal processing (DSP) and high-speed digital design principles.
Experience with simulation tools (e.g., ModelSim, Vivado Simulator, QuestaSim) and hardware debugging tools (e.g., oscilloscopes, logic analyzers).
Familiarity with embedded systems and software development (C/C++ and/or Python experience is a plus).
Excellent problem-solving skills, great aptitude for analysis, and ability to work in a collaborative environment.
Preferred Qualifications
Advanced Degree.
Experience with Xilinx Zynq SoC FPGA family.
Knowledge of communication protocols (e.g., SPI, I2C, Ethernet) and interfaces (e.g., PCIe, DDR).
Proven track record of successful project delivery in a fast-paced environment.
